As a key member of our Product Innovation team, you'll play a hands-on role in supporting the development and testing of next-generation SharkNinja products. From circuit-level troubleshooting to lab-based validation and verification, you'll work alongside experienced engineers to refine electrical systems, test new components, and ensure our products meet the highest standards of performance and reliability. Here are some of the EXCITING things you'll get to do :

  • Contribute to the development of cutting-edge technologies that will power the next generation of SharkNinja products
  • Support senior engineers in designing and testing analog and digital circuits-including low-noise analog systems, microprocessors, A / D and D / A converters, and power supply architectures
  • Assist with board bring-up, debugging, and validation of real-time embedded electronics
  • Help develop and refine microprocessor-based control and communication platforms through simulation, analysis, prototyping, and hands-on lab testing
  • Collaborate on cross-functional problem-solving to support released products and conduct failure analysis for field-reported issues
  • Participate in technical reviews and contribute to design documentation, test plans, and technical reports
  • Work closely with Mechanical Engineering, Marketing, and Product Testing teams to ensure electrical solutions align with product goals and user expectations

ATTRIBUTES & SKILLS :

  • Education : Must be currently enrolled in a bachelor's, master's, or doctoral program, or have graduated within the past year
  • Must be an electrical engineering major
  • Must be able to work a full-time, 40-hour-per-week schedule with 5 days per week onsite in Needham, MA
  • Strong understanding of Bipolar and CMOS technologies; foundational knowledge in power electronics is preferred
  • Able to quickly develop visual and physical representations of product functions and electrical layouts
  • Combines creativity with technical expertise to generate innovative, real-world solutions
  • Experience with electrical design tools such as LTSpice; familiarity with PCB design software like Altium is a plus
  • Exposure to product-level testing including DC / AC performance, power consumption, BLDC motors, and EMC considerations is a bonus
  • Prior internship or project experience in consumer electronics or small appliances is a strong asset
  • Hands-on lab experience with test equipment (oscilloscopes, function generators, power supplies, SMUs); surface mount soldering skills are a plus
  • Proficient in Microsoft 365; experience with Visual Basic programming is a plus
